Rifle Scopes Seven Scopes with Issues or Something Else

Seems I have a scope issue times seven scopes. It also seems like this is a legit issue. So, with that said I have a question for you dudes. Has anyone else seen an impact shift when dropping the rifle on a bag and taking a shot?

What started all this was trying to get my build and break times down. I’d shoot five shots from five different positions for time trying to keep them all in the #1 diamond on the Kraft Target. When I went from high kneeling to standing I dropped the rifle on the bag from about 12” in a hatchet type movement pushing to make up time. Hand on grip, forearm approximately 12” above the bag and let the rifle drop angling down to the bag. I noticed the shot went low when I called it center diamond. I shot again to confirm and it was center. I thought that was weird so I repeated the process and first shot was low, second shot was center. My mind went into overtime knowing there was an issue, but what was causing it? My first thought was chassis. Swapped around with three chassis to no resolve. Ok, it’s a barrel issue, again three barrels with no resolve. So I texted a dude that likes to test stuff. He said nope never tested that or heard of it but I’ll look into it. Only one thing left to do swap scopes and see what’s up. The results are below and they speak for themselves. What say you?

Here is the process I used to confirm the results checking different scopes.

- All shots were from standing position.
- Held grip, the rifle is 12” above bag, release forearm and rifle falls onto bag.
- Fire first shot.
- Pan over to next target and fire second shot.
- Pick up rifle and repeat for a total of 5 shots per target/10 rounds total.

Here is the list of scopes tested:
- Gen 2 Razor 4.5-27
- Zero Compromise 4-20
- Nightforce NXS 5.5-22
- Gen 3 Razor 6-36
- Leupold MK4 Fixed 16x
- Gen 2 Razor 3-18
- Viper PST 5-25

Chassis that were tried early on to eliminate that thought:
- AIATX
- XLR Envy Pro
- Early XLR Envy

Barrels Tested to remove that thought:
- 26” Proof 6mm
- 26” Bartlien
- 26” Proof 6.5mm

The last thing I tried was dropping the rifle onto the bag dialing the scope up and down to remove any lash then return to zero and fire. It fixed nothing.

Gunsmithing Gunsmith said this about installing a Tikka prefit

Ok, bought a m24 Mueller 204 barrel from bugholes/Southern Precision and had them thread it for my Tikka and also chamber it. I didn’t have them install it on my rifle because they said it would take some absurd amount of time due to their backlog.

The barrel just came in the mail. Brought the barreled action to a gunsmith in town and asked for him to remove the factory barrel and install the bugholes barrel.

Note that I’ve never had anybody install a barrel, nor ever installed a barrel myself. Currently, due to remodeling my garage is full and I have no workbench or even a place to mount a barrel vice etc to change my own barrels.

He said:
  1. Removing factory barrel: “I use lead in my barrel vice to clamp around the barrel. But with Tikka barrels being on so tight, the barrel just spins in the lead. Therefore I can’t use the lead so you might have some scratches on the barrel.”
  2. On new barrel install: “Just so you know, I always have to touch up the chamber when I install a barrel (head spacing). And please bring in the stock because I want to test fire to make sure everything is safe.”
Should I be using this guy?
